Manglerud was a borough of the city of
Oslo,
Norway up to
January 1 2004, when it became part of the borough of
Østensjø. Manglerud was built in the 1960s as a suburb to Oslo, connected by the
Oslo T-bane metro system.
Sport
Manglerud's
ice hockey team
Manglerud Star has delivered more players to professional hockey leagues around the world than any other hockey team in Norway. For the 2004/2005 season, Manglerud Star played in the first division after financial problems, being relegated from the
Eliteserie, but after the qualification league at the end of the season, they were back at the top level for the 2005/2006 season. After competing against the 05/06-finalist Trondheim in the Eliteserie qualification, which was surprisingly low-levelled at that season, they were relegated to the level 2-league first division for 2006/07. Many people claim
Mats Trygg to be the best M/S player ever, he was playing for
Färjestads BK in
Sweden during the 2004/2005 season, but plays the 2005/2006 season for
Iserlohn Roosters in
Germany, together with his best friend and partner in the national team of Norway
Martin Knold. In 2004, the city of Oslo provided funding for a new sports hall, which also includes a
football arena beside the hockey rink.
Tunet IBK is also situated here. The floorball team has been in the Eliteserie for 11 years running. The women's team has won the NM, Norwegian Championship, 5 times.
The men's team has won NM, Norwegian Championship, 2 times. Johnny Finstad started the club and has spawned 33 national team players over the years. (As of 1 September 2006) Morten Finstad is the only player whose number, 19, has been retired, as a sign of respect for the time and effort he has spent on the club.
Music
Manglerud was the home of
Pål Waaktaar and
Magne Furuholmen when they founded
a-ha.
